Berlin Homeowner’s Guide to Selecting an Oil Company
For Berlin households heating with fuel oil, picking which of the 12 heating oil companies that serve Berlin plays a big role in determining how much money is spent on heating each winter.
Full Service Oil Companies: Homeowners who are willing to pay a premium for a “set-it-and-forget-it” heating system select one of the 7 “full-service” oil companies that serve Berlin. Full service companies such as Morse Fuels LLC or Doug's Oil Inc offer families annual contracts which consist of a combined package of both automatic oil delivery and boiler repair. With an automatic number two heating oil delivery contract, the company tracks your home’s heating oil consumption and makes deliveries when your tank is running low. The family does not need to monitor the level of the oil tank or place individual orders.
Discount Oil Companies: Also known by the names “COD Fuel” or “Cash Heating Oil” companies, discount oil companies are for homeowners who are on a budget. With discount oil companies, in exchange for lower prices, you monitor the oil level in your tank, and you place an oil order either when the level runs low or just before a major snowstorm. A few of the 2 Berlin cash heating oil companies serving Berlin include Kokosa Oil Inc and MainCare Express.

Heating Oil (Fuel Oil) Use in Berlin
Fuel oil has become more popular in Berlin. In the 10 years since 2015, the number of households using fuel oil shot up from 181 to 199, a 10% gain.
Propane vs. Natural Gas use for home heating in Berlin
Between 2015 and today, the number of households using propane as the primary space heating fuel rose from 12 to 45, a 275% change. Comparing 2015 and today, the number of homes using natural gas as the primary space heating fuel jumped from 17 to 31, a 82% change.
Electricity use for home heating in Berlin
Electric heat pump systems for home heating are less popular in Berlin. Since 2015, the number of homes heating with electricity decreased from 51 to 44, a 14% change.
Adoption of solar home heating systems in Berlin
Out of all fuels, solar is the safest for the environment. With an “active” solar heating system, liquid is circulated between solar panels on a home’s roof and a heat energy storage tank (similar to a hot water heater) in the basement. Today, 2 homes in Berlin are heated with active solar arrays. This is a 71% drop from 2015, when 7 homes utilized active solar heating.

Oil delivery is a two step process: First, an oil truck picks up oil at the nearest bulk fuel terminal (also known as a “rack”). In the case of Berlin, two of the closest terminals are Sprague in Bridgeport, CT and N.h.term in New Haven, CT. Then, the truck delivers the fuel oil to residences and companies throughout Berlin and the surrounding vicinity.
